What is CVE-2025-6555?

A use after free vulnerability in the Animation component of Google Chrome allows remote attackers to exploit heap corruption by crafting a malicious HTML page. This could lead to potential arbitrary code execution or system compromise, necessitating immediate updates from users to maintain security.

Affected Version(s)

Chrome 138.0.7204.49
